The fun about managing a website is two-fold - firstly, it’s cool to analyse the stats. You can look at where everyone is coming from, what they’re doing. You can see how much time people spend on your site. For example, people searching for “unblock hotmail” spend 11:35 on my site. Those searching for make money online have averaged over 20 minutes. Obviously, I have picked examples that make me look good.

Bounce rate is a pretty key stat. If someone gets to your site and clicks back within… 60 seconds I think it is, without doing anything, the stats software records this as a ‘bounce.’ I’ve dropped this by 15% but it still seems high to me. So I won’t say exactly what it is. ;)

In the past month, people have found my site through search engines using 397 different key-words. 3-9-7. Unfortunately a lot of the ‘long-tail’ search terms such as “2nd hand furniture on the gold coast” have 100% bounce rate because my site cannot help them.
